As a new special auxiliary, polyether-modified agricultural organic silicone surfactant is widely used in various fields of agricultural planting due to its excellent physical and chemical properties, becoming an important auxiliary material for refined modern agricultural management.
According to technical data of the agricultural auxiliary industry, optimized by polyether modification technology, this organic silicone product has extremely low surface tension, as well as excellent spreadability, permeability and emulsifying dispersibility, with comprehensive performance superior to traditional ordinary auxiliaries. In terms of solubility, it features strong adaptability, soluble in various organic solvents such as methanol, isopropanol and acetone, and evenly dispersible in water. It is compatible with most agricultural spraying formulas with stable performance and will not react with raw materials, effectively ensuring the stability and activity of original ingredients.
In practical agricultural applications, this auxiliary has a wide range of uses. It can be applied as a spray improver, leaf absorption auxiliary and activity synergist, matching pesticides, herbicides, crop growth regulators, foliar nutrients and other agricultural products. Traditional spraying often faces problems such as liquid rolling off leaves, uneven adhesion and slow penetration, resulting in material waste and poor maintenance effects. Adding this organic silicone auxiliary can effectively reduce the surface tension of liquid solution and narrow the contact angle between liquid droplets and crop leaf or pest surfaces.
This improvement significantly enhances the wetting, adhesion and spreading capacity of the liquid, enabling even coverage on crop surfaces and accelerating the penetration and absorption of effective ingredients to avoid liquid loss and waste.
